Starts just on the northwest side of the bridge and is extremely well marked. Recommend going counterclockwise. There is a fire road that connects the end back to the beginning.<br><br>It begins with a nice ride along the river. Very smooth at this point with no technical features. At about the 0.75-mile point, it turns left and starts to climb up the hill. About 0.5 miles later, there is a nice little offshoot to Elko Point that you can add in as an out-and-back. <br><br>After another 0.3 miles of climbing, you come to the top (and the trail junction to Afternoon Delight). From here, it's mostly nice swishy downhill with the occasional small rock garden to play in. <br><br>About 0.5 miles down from the top, there is a quick, fun little gully with some well-positioned logs to force you to chicane back and forth across the gully. <br><br>Eventually, it pops out back on the fire road where you can easily connect to Swan Song, or head back to the beginning for another loop.
